Seamless Guttering


Leaky gutters damage roofs and siding and allow water to soak into the basement. Gutter problems are easy to eliminate by changing classic drains with seamless ones, as no joints and seams mean no leaks. They can be installed in continuous lengths, and seamless guttering services can come to your property and manufacture gutter directly onsite. Cut energy costs


Monthly expenses of energy may seem like a fixed amount, but many local utility companies provide free energy advice, and they can show you how to maximise the energy efficiency of your home.

Your Electrician Gold Coast adds "An energy-efficient home will save you money now, and it is a more valuable and marketable asset in the long run. One of the possibilities of reducing energy costs is to install a whole-house fan. It is an excellent alternative to air conditioning because it uses only one-tenth the electricity of air conditioners. Another possibility is to install a solar water heater. These two are considered a "green" home improvement, which is one of favourite selling feature with today's homebuyers."

Create the look of more space


Many buyers find open floor plans more attractive. A good option to visually enlarge space is to knock out a wall that is dividing two rooms. It creates the illusion of more space and still the square footage of the property remains unchanged. Turning the basement or attic from a storage space into a living space will not be adding to the actual square footage of a home, but it will be adding to the square footage of the liveable areas. If you don’t want to do any more significant reconstructions of a house, you can visually increase space by adding a piece of mirrored furniture, or a big mirror into a room.

These are only some suggestions of possibilities in remodelling your home that will increase property price when selling it. Before you start working on your house, do some research on your area to find out how much the property will be worth after the renovations. Take the list and categorise by how much each step of improvement may cost, including your time and money. Be sure that you don’t over-improve your property and spend an amount of money on a renovation where you will not see a return on your investment.
